#6f490b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f490b is composed of 43.5% red, 28.6%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 90.1%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 37.2 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 23.9%. #6f490b color hex could be obtained by blending #de9216 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#6f490b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6f490b has RGB values of R:111, G:73,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.9,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7293195.

Shades and Tints of #6f490b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fef9f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f490b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403e3a is the less saturated color, while #784b02 is the most saturated one.
